Definitions
not having a shiny coating
Word origin
From un- + glazed.
Used in a sentence
“Unglazed tiles, dull rather than glossy, are usually laid on floors—although nothing precludes their use on walls.”
“For an unglazed ham, you dress the fat with golden breadcrumbs. For a glazed ham you can become even more fancy.”
“The unglazed donuts can be frozen for up to a month.”
